Costa Rica vs. Fiji: The Central American Jewel vs. The Pacific Pearl
A Tale of Two Paradises
At first glance, comparing Costa Rica and Fiji seems like choosing between two perfect postcards of paradise. Costa Rica is the "Central American Jewel," a land of volcanoes and rainforests nestled between two great oceans. Fiji is the "Pacific Pearl," an archipelago of over 300 idyllic islands defined by coral reefs, turquoise lagoons, and the famously warm "Bula" spirit. Both are magnets for tourists seeking sun, sand, and nature. Yet, their locations, cultures, and the very essence of their paradises are worlds apart.
The Most Striking Contrasts
- Geography: Costa Rica is a continental isthmus, a land bridge with a solid, mountainous spine. You can drive from one side to the other. Fiji is a classic archipelago, a scattering of volcanic islands in the vast Pacific Ocean. Life is dictated by the sea, and travel between islands requires boats or small planes.
- Cultural Roots: Costa Rica is a Spanish-speaking, Latin American nation. Its culture is a blend of Spanish colonial heritage and a peaceful, agrarian society. Fiji has a unique Melanesian culture, with strong Polynesian influences, alongside a significant Indo-Fijian population. English is an official language, and the native Fijian and Fiji Hindi languages are widely spoken.
- The Nature on Offer: Costa Rica's draw is its incredible land-based biodiversity: monkeys, sloths, toucans, and dense jungles. Fiji's magic lies underwater. It is the "Soft Coral Capital of the World," offering some of the planet's most spectacular diving and snorkeling among vibrant reefs and marine life.
- Vibe and Spirit: Costa Rica's motto is "Pura Vida" (Simple Life), a philosophy of laid-back, stress-free living. Fiji's is "Bula," which means "life" or "health" and is used as an enthusiastic, all-purpose greeting. While both are friendly, Fijian hospitality is legendary for its communal warmth and effusiveness.
The Quality vs. Quantity Paradox
Costa Rica offers a "quantity" of easily accessible ecosystems. You can experience cloud forests, dry forests, volcanoes, and two different coastlines within a small area. The infrastructure makes it easy to sample this variety. Fiji offers a "quality" of pure, immersive island experience. You might stay on one or two islands, but you will experience that specific place—its beaches, its reef, its village—deeply. It’s about depth over breadth.

The Tourist Experience
A Costa Rican vacation is an active one—hiking, zip-lining, surfing, and driving to different regions. A Fijian vacation is about surrender—relaxing on a perfect beach, snorkeling in a calm lagoon, visiting a local village, and letting the world melt away. One is an adventure for the body; the other is a restorative for the soul.
Conclusion: Which World Do You Choose?
Choosing Costa Rica is choosing an accessible, diverse, land-based adventure. It’s a country that offers a perfect balance of untamed nature and modern comfort. Choosing Fiji is embracing the romance of the South Pacific. It’s a choice for pure relaxation, for underwater wonder, and for experiencing a hospitality that is as warm and clear as its waters.
